LOSS OF SUMATRA

“A NATIONAL DISASTER.” (Australian and N.Z. Cable Association.) MELBOURNE, July 11. Tn the House of Representatives the Prime Minister (Mr Bruce) announced that the Ministry had asked the New South Wales Government to hold an enquiry into the sinking of the Sumatra, and was awaiting the result. They regarded the loss as almost a national disaster.
